-
Apexon

Senior Java Developer

Apexon
Ireland · Full-time · Mid-Senior

About Apexon:

Apexon brings together distinct core competencies – in AI, analytics, app development, cloud, commerce, CX, data, DevOps, IoT, mobile, quality engineering and UX, and our deep expertise in BFSI, healthcare, and life sciences – to help businesses capitalize on the unlimited opportunities digital offers. Our reputation is built on a comprehensive suite of engineering services, a dedication to solving clients’ toughest technology problems, and a commitment to continuous improvement.

Backed by Goldman Sachs Asset Management and Everstone Capital, Apexon now has a global presence.


We are seeking a skilled Java Developer who is experienced in building modern, scalable applications using Java, Spring Boot, Microservices, RESTful APIs, Docker, Kafka, Kubernetes, and AWS. The ideal candidate thrives in a fast-paced environment and enjoys solving complex technical challenges.


Responsibilities


  • Design, develop, test, and deploy robust Java-based applications.
  • Build and maintain RESTful APIs and microservices using Spring Boot.
  • Collaborate with cross-functional teams to define, design, and deliver new features.
  • Integrate applications with various cloud services on AWS.
  • Manage containerization and orchestration using Docker and Kubernetes.
  • Implement event-driven architectures using messaging systems like Kafka.
  • Write efficient, clean, and well-documented code.
  • Troubleshoot and resolve technical issues across the software development lifecycle.
  • Participate in code reviews and enforce best development practices.
  • Maintain technical documentation related to architecture, database, and design.


Requirements


  • Bachelor’s degree in Computer Science, Engineering, or a related field (or equivalent experience).
  • 3+ years of hands-on experience in Java application development.
  • Strong expertise with Spring Boot framework.
  • Solid experience building and maintaining microservices architectures.
  • In-depth knowledge of REST API design and implementation.
  • Proficiency in Docker for containerization.
  • Experience with Kafka for event streaming and messaging.
  • Familiarity with Kubernetes for orchestration and deployment.
  • Practical experience using AWS cloud services (e.g., EC2, S3, Lambda, RDS).
  • Strong understanding of version control systems like Git.
  • Excellent problem-solving, analytical, and communication skills.


Nice to Have


  • Exposure to CI/CD tools and pipelines (e.g., Jenkins, GitLab CI).
  • Experience with monitoring and logging (e.g., Prometheus, ELK Stack).
  • Knowledge of security best practices in distributed systems.
  • Familiarity with other messaging platforms (e.g., RabbitMQ).

Key Skills

Ranked by relevance

java cloud microservices restful apis docker containerization spring boot kubernetes prometheus jenkins devops gitlab kafka cicd aws elk ai s3 ux
Login to Apply
Posted
Jul 22, 2025
Type
Full-time
Level
Mid-Senior
Location
Dublin
Company
Apexon

Industries

IT Services IT Consulting Financial Services Banking

Categories

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Apexon
Related

Senior Java Developer

2026-04-25

Full-time
Mid-Senior
Ireland
IT Services
Information Technology
View Job Details
Apexon
Related

Java Developer

2026-05-07

Full-time
Associate
United Kingdom
IT Services
Information Technology
View Job Details
LHV
Related

Product Engineer (Investment Platform)

2026-05-28

Full-time
Mid-Senior
Estonia
IT Services
Engineering